O’Shea Agrees With Golden Rose Stakes Betting Market

Trainer John O’Shea agrees with the 2015 Golden Rose Stakes betting market and he believes that Exosphere is his best winning chance in the Group 1 event at Rosehill Gardens this weekend.

Exosphere failed to beat home a single runner in the Group 1 Golden Slipper Stakes (1200m) at Rosehill Gardens on March 21, but he returned to racing with an outstanding performance in the Group 2 Run To The Rose (1200m) at Rosehill Gardens on August 29.

O’Shea believes that Exosphere is the horse to beat in the Group 1 Golden Rose Stakes (1400m), but he believes that the son of Lonhro may need some luck in running when he jumps from the inside gate.

“We are really happy and optimistic with all three runners,” O’Shea said.

“I think that the market has got it right, but we are just going to need luck with Exosphere.

“He is a talented horse and we have been really happy with him coming into the race.

“For me he presents with an awkward barrier in two and he is going to need a little bit of luck in running and a good McDonald ride to get him into the finish.

“He will either come to the outside or cut the corner and ride for a bit of luck.

“We will just leave that to James.

“He has made nice improvement with the run under his belt and he worked well during the week.”

Shards is currently available at 2015 Golden Rose Stakes odds of $11 and is on the fourth line of betting after he returned to the races with a fast-finishing victory in the Group 3 Up And Coming Stakes (1300m) at Royal Randwick on August 22.

The Medaglia D’Oro colt beat a quality field to take out a benchmark event over 1350 metres at Rosehill Gardens on June 13 and O’Shea believes that the three-year-old is set to get a lovely run in transit in the Golden Rose Stakes.

“He presents with good stats over 1400 metres at Rosehill Gardens,” O’Shea said.

“He looks to map very well in the race and he has come on since his first-up win.”
